    A lot of us use these:

    http://www.pachitalk.com/auction/Vol...uction_details

    They are easy to install and work well. If you plan on changing the volume a lot then you may want the bigger pots or go with LPADs since you can mount a big knob somewhere. Personally I just install the small volume controls like in the auction, set them to a good level and hardly ever touch them again.

    That control would work great in some machines like King Camel. The one I have Raises the volume up when it goes into a bonus round.

    It is allot easier for me to just turn the knob from the outside to lower the volume each time a bonus round is entered than having to open up the machine. Then turn it back up after the round is finished.
